What Are System Files and Why Are They Important?

System files are core components of the Windows operating system. They include drivers, libraries, and executables that allow Windows and applications to function correctly. Damage to these files can cause significant issues, from minor glitches to complete system failure.

1. Using the System File Checker (SFC)

The System File Checker is a built-in tool that scans and repairs corrupted system files.

– Open Command Prompt as Administrator: Type “cmd” in the Start menu, right-click on Command Prompt, and select “Run as administrator”.
– Run SFC: Type `sfc /scannow` and press Enter. This command will begin checking for system file integrity and attempt repairs automatically.
– Review the Results: Once the scan is complete, review the results in the Command Prompt to see if any issues were repaired.

1. Using the Deployment Imaging Service and Management Tool (DISM)

DISM is another powerful tool that can fix issues that the SFC tool may not resolve.

– Open Command Prompt as Administrator.
– Prepare the Image: Use the command `DISM /Online /Cleanup-Image /CheckHealth` to check if the image has any corruption.
– Repair the Image: Run `DISM /Online /Cleanup-Image /RestoreHealth` to download and restore corrupted files from Windows Update or another source.

2. Conducting a System Restore

If recent changes have caused system file corruption, you can revert your PC to a previous state using System Restore.

– Access System Restore: Type “System Restore” in the Start menu search and select “Create a restore point”.
– Choose a Restore Point: Follow the prompts and choose a restore point before the issues began.
– Start the Restore: Confirm your selection and allow the process to complete. This will revert system files and settings to an earlier point in time.

3. Manual Replacement of System Files

In extreme cases, manually replacing corrupted files may be necessary.

– Identify the Corrupted File: Use Event Viewer or other diagnostic tools to pinpoint the corrupted file.
– Obtain a Clean Copy: Acquire a copy of the file from another computer running the same version of Windows.
– Replace the File: Boot into Safe Mode and replace the corrupted file in the system directory.
